    Study Notes

    Driving Privileges and Restrictions

    • Parents and the State of Washington can revoke driving privileges.
    • Intermediate License restrictions include no driving with electronics, limited to friends under 20 years, and nighttime driving limitations.
    • The maximum number of passengers under 20 allowed in a vehicle with a provisional teen driver is three.

    Safe Driving Practices

    • No use of electronics is permitted while driving; all devices must be set up before driving begins.
    • Fatal crashes among teens are commonly attributed to factors such as drowsiness, distraction, inexperience, night driving, impaired driving, reckless driving, lack of seat belts, and teen passengers.
    • Under-inflated tires may trigger low tire warning lights when they are 25% below recommended pressure.

    Visibility and Situational Awareness

    • Use lane position 2 if there’s a threat on the right side of your vehicle.
    • Creating space and time, communicating intentions, and checking related zones are crucial tools for managing driving threats.
    • The goal when facing multiple threats is to isolate and separate them.

    Traffic Control and Intersections

    • At intersections, yield to the person on your right, pedestrians in your path, and others already in the intersection.
    • A Green traffic light requires scanning for threats first before proceeding.

    Vehicle Control and Handling

    • Proper tire positioning while parking on a hill should ensure front tires hit the curb if the vehicle rolls.
    • Maintain a minimum following distance of six seconds when driving at freeway speeds to ensure adequate reaction time.

    Impaired Driving and Safety Statistics

    • Alcohol significantly increases the risk of addiction, especially if consumption begins before age 15, leading to a 5x higher risk.
    • At .08 BAC, individuals are considered legally drunk, with impairment levels increasing at lower BACs.

    Environmental and Road Conditions

    • Adjustments like slowing down, gentle braking, and creating space are vital when driving on snow or icy roads.
    • The “Move Over Law” mandate creates a 200 feet safety zone around first responders and tow trucks.

    Night Driving Considerations

    • Night driving is impaired by reduced depth perception, muted colors, and increased tunnel vision.
    • For safe night driving, low beam headlights should be used in fog or snow, providing clearer visibility without blinding other drivers.

    Motorcyclists and Bicyclists Safety

    • Maintain at least three feet of space when passing a bicyclist.
    • Recognize that motorcyclists have similar rights as pedestrians when on sidewalks.

    Emergency Protocols

    • If brakes smell burning, pull off the road to allow them to cool.
    • When approaching long downhill grades, shift into lower gear to decrease reliance on brakes and prevent failure.
